I say tentative as the race has only been run 5 times , the last 3 of which were run on the AW but the trends seem to be holding up .
KEMPTON -2.40 - Listed Fillies Stakes - 8f
-----------------------------------------------------
5/5 were from the top 3 in the betting
5/5 had won at least once
5/5 ran in Listed/Group company LTO
4/5 were 4y-olds , other was 5y-old.
Whilst only
1 previous winner had won at Listed level the other
4 had finished within 4l of the winner when running in Listed or Group company.

First to be discounted is DIXEY who has NEVER ran in Listed/Group company in it's career never mind last time out .
Coupled with the fact that it rated at least 6lb's below the rest and her 2 wins were over 7f , well btn last of 13 in it's reappearance last season in a 8f Newmarket Handicap.
BORN TOBOUGGIE ran in a Listed race on it's final appearance last season and finished 5th , btn under 4l .
However it's only other run in this grade ended with a 25l beating at Yarmouth.
2 of her career wins came on G/S and Soft going whilst the other was on Good going but according to the RP review it was run 'at a muddling pace ' so i'm doubtful it has the class on this surface to win .
PERFECT STAR is the only 5 y-old in the race and while 4/5 runnings ahve been won by a 4y-o the bigger picture shows that only 11 horses aged 5+ have ran and in each running at least one was placed and a 5yo won it last season.
She has won at Listed grade but that was in HANDICAP company and LTO was a well btn 3rd [ 7l ] at Bath in a Listed race.
First run on an AW surface.
Again , i have a doubt that she has the class to beat the selection.
SCUFFLE won a Cl 5 Maiden and two Cl3 Handicaps in the space of 3 months before finishing an 8l 10th of 16 in a Listed race at Redcar on her final appearance , but that was over 7f while her wins were all over the 8f.
With only 5 career rauns under her belt there could still be a fair bit of improvement to come .
The stable has had three 2nd's and two 3rd's all beaten under 2l so they are knocking hard at the door .
FESTOSO carries the Nap tomorrow .
Her one and only win so far was her debut in a Newmarket Maiden over 6f but her subsequent 6 outings after that were all between Listed and Group 1 grade .
The best of these were a 2nd in the Cherry Hinton [grp 2] , 4th in the Lowther [grp 2] and 3rd in the Cheveley Park [grp 1] as a 2yold.
She then wasn't seen for nearly 11 months when re-appearing in a Listed race at Doncaster where she finished 3rd btn 1l .
Her final race of last season was in the Grp 1 Sun Chariot at Newmarket where she finished 9th , 20l behind the winner .
Harry Dunlop has had 2 wins from 7 runners in the past 14 days so the stable sems in good order and i think he's found the perfect opportunity for his charge to start a new season at a grade where she must have a winning chance , imo of course .
One niggly worry is the fact that she has done most of her running over 6/7f but her breeding suggests the mile should suit .
